Where to stay, dine & explore

Where to stay

The Hay-Adams keeps the White House out your window, and Four Seasons Georgetown remains the power-breakfast default. Rosewood Washington DC on the C&O Canal is the quiet luxury pick, while The Jefferson does small-hotel polish steps from downtown. Near Dulles and Tysons, The Ritz-Carlton, Tysons Corner handles the corridor-meeting overnight.

Where to dine

Le Diplomate is still the city's clubhouse; book The Dabney for mid-Atlantic cooking that earned its star, and minibar by José Andrés when you want the show. Fiola Mare covers the Georgetown waterfront client dinner, Rasika the best Indian in America, and Old Ebbitt Grill the classic pre-dawn-flight oyster stop.

What to do

Walk the monuments at dawn before the crowds, take a private after-hours tour of the Smithsonian collections, and catch whatever's at the Kennedy Center. Georgetown's shops and the National Gallery fill a spare afternoon; in spring, time the trip to the cherry blossoms and thank us later.

Getting there

Washington, DC-area airports

Flying private means choosing the field closest to where you're actually headed — not just the big commercial hub. These are the airports we use for Washington, DC:

KIAD
Washington Dulles International — the workhorse for private arrivals, with full-service FBOs and easy access to Tysons, Reston, and the tech corridor.
KDCA
Ronald Reagan Washington National — closest to downtown and the Hill, available for DASSP-approved private operations; we coordinate the security requirements with advance notice.
KHEF
Manassas Regional — the value play with quick fees and a straightforward 35–45 minute run into the District.
